Nurse Manager - Specialty Outpatient Services
Role Summary

Howard University Hospital is seeking a Nurse Manager - Specialty Outpatient Services to provide operational and clinical leadership for specialty outpatient programs, including infusion services, diabetes education, wound care, and other ambulatory specialty services. Reporting to the Director of Specialty Outpatient Services, this role oversees daily operations, staffing, quality outcomes, regulatory compliance, and patient care delivery across assigned programs.

This leader will collaborate with physicians, nursing leadership, and interdisciplinary teams to ensure safe, efficient, and patient-centered care. The Nurse Manager will also step into clinical duties as needed to support staffing and operational continuity.
What You'll Do
  • Lead daily operations of specialty outpatient clinical programs including infusion, diabetes, wound care, and related ambulatory services
  • Supervise, develop, and evaluate nursing and support staff
  • Manage staffing plans and scheduling to maintain safe clinical coverage
  • Provide direct clinical care when needed to support staffing, patient safety, and continuity of operations
  • Monitor quality, patient safety, patient experience, and departmental performance metrics
  • Support regulatory readiness and ensure compliance with Joint Commission, CMS, DC Department of Health, and other applicable standards
  • Participate in budget monitoring, resource management, and operational improvement efforts
  • Partner with physicians, leadership, and interdisciplinary teams to improve care coordination and service delivery
  • Support strategic initiatives and growth of specialty outpatient services
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's Degree in Nursing (BSN) required
  • Master's Degree in Nursing, Healthcare Administration, or a related field preferred
  • Minimum five (5) years of clinical nursing experience required
  • Leadership or supervisory experience in a healthcare setting preferred
  • Experience in ambulatory services, infusion therapy, wound care, cardiology services, or other specialty outpatient programs preferred
  • Current Registered Nurse license in the District of Columbia required
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ification required
  •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) certification required
  • Strong leadership, communication, organizational, and performance improvement skills

Pay + Schedule

Salary Range: $94,842 - $151,746 annually

Compensation is determined based on experience, education, and internal equity.

Position Type: Full-Time

FLSA Status: Exempt

Schedule: Primarily Monday-Friday, daytime hours, with occasional evening or weekend coverage based on operational needs.

About Howard University

Howard University is a private, federally chartered historically black university (HBCU) in Washington, D.C. It is categorized by the Carnegie Foundation as a research university with higher research activity and is accredited by the Middle States Commission on Higher Education. From its outset Howard has been nonsectarian and open to people of all sexes and races. Howard offers more than 120 areas leading to undergraduate, graduate, and professional degrees.
